The old town is an Istrean treasure. Typically Provençal, it is evidence of our beautiful town’s history. It can be visited as a group, with the family or alone, with a guide or with the ‘Istres Through its History’ leaflet.
Istres has a real historic centre, which was formerly fortified and was built on a limestone bed rich in fossilised oysters. It formed a hill with an oval base (about 250 m by 188 m) stretching from north to south and with a central peak rising 30 m above sea level. This village perched on a rocky hilltop is typical of Mediterranean rural settlements, around which the town of Istres was built.
